Bada Bing, Bada Boom: Pronto Opens Tonite
By Christopher St Cavish, Feb 9th, 2010 | In Nightlife
Pronto opens on the corner of Xiangyang and Julu Lu tonight. It's a "New York-style" Italian restaurant, which, I guess, means red sauce and Italian-American standards. It could even be authentic inauthentic Italian-American food, as all three times I've seen the chef, he's been wearing an old leather jacket. I think that counts for something.
Dishes on their menu, via their PR blurb: "Fried Calamari, Pappardelle Bolognese, Lasagane, Ravioli, Bruschetta, Zuppe De Pesce over Linguine, Chicken Marsala, Veal Milanese and signature dishes such as Pistachio Crusted Rack of Lamb, Snapper Portofino and Jumbo Prawn Scampi."
They already take credit cards, which is nice for a brand-new venue, but there's one catch -- they've gotta be breaded, deep-fried, covered in red sauce, and have a slice of mozz melted over the top. Zing.
